Transaction 080bcdfd4c76fe893a21a3fc8bb43a4fe279a1088169865cb307bcb74a4e0e66
1 Input
1 Output
-
080bcdfd4c76fe893a21a3fc8bb43a4fe279a1088169865cb307bcb74a4e0e66:0
- value
- 40393
- script pubkey
- OP_0 OP_PUSHBYTES_20 de68f867604768c5b2966dc2c14b6e38dceca49d
- address
- bc1qme50semqga5vtv5kdhpvzjmw8rwwefyazxu0hj